Key Elements of a Farewell Party

 Here are some key elements and ideas to consider when planning a farewell party:

  1. Invitations: Send out invitations well in advance to ensure that everyone important can attend. You can use traditional paper invitations, digital invites, or even create a Facebook event.
  2. Venue: Choose a venue that suits the number of guests and the atmosphere you want to create. It can be a restaurant, banquet hall, office space, or even someone’s home.
  3. Theme: Consider having a theme for the farewell party. It could be based on the person’s interests or something fun and lighthearted that everyone can enjoy.
  4. Decorations: Decorate the venue in a way that reflects the mood of the event. Balloons, banners, streamers, and personalized items like photo collages or posters can be great additions.
  5. Speeches and Toasts: Plan a segment where friends and colleagues can give heartfelt speeches or toasts, sharing fond memories, and expressing their appreciation for the person leaving.
  6. Games and Activities: Organize some fun games and activities that everyone can participate in. This can help break the ice and create a relaxed and enjoyable atmosphere.
  7. Gifts: Consider presenting a farewell gift to the person leaving as a token of appreciation and remembrance. It could be something meaningful or related to their interests.
  8. Music and Entertainment: Arrange for some background music or even a DJ to keep the atmosphere lively. You can also include a slideshow or video montage of memorable moments shared with the departing individual.
  9. Food and Drinks: Depending on the venue and budget, arrange for a selection of food and drinks that everyone will enjoy.
  10. Photo Booth: Set up a photo booth with props and a backdrop to capture the fun and memorable moments.
  11. Guestbook: Provide a guestbook for attendees to write personal messages and well wishes for the person leaving.
  12. Embrace the Emotions: Farewell parties can be emotional, especially for the person leaving and those closest to them. Embrace the emotions and create an atmosphere of support and positivity.

 

Tips to choose the right saree for farewell party

With all the key elements covered, you must now start focusing on what makes you look beautiful, comfortable, and yet look all glammed up for the farewell party. And, to achieve all this, what better than draping in a saree? So, here are some tips to consider while choosing a saree for farewell party:

  1. Fabric: Opt for a fabric that drapes well and feels comfortable to wear for an extended period. Lightweight fabrics like georgette, chiffon, crepe, or silk are great options as they allow ease of movement and create a graceful look.
  2. Color: Choose a color that compliments your skin tone and enhances your overall appearance. Classic colors like royal blue, deep red, emerald green, or rich maroon often work well for such occasions. If you prefer pastels or lighter shades, ensure they are not too casual and have a touch of sophistication.
  3. Embellishments: For a farewell party, a saree with subtle or elegant embellishments like embroidery, sequins, or zari work can add a touch of glamor without being overwhelming.
  4. Design and Pattern: Opt for a saree with a design and pattern that suits your personal style and the formality of the event. You can go for traditional motifs or contemporary designs, depending on your preferences and the overall theme of the farewell party.
  5. Blouse: Consider a well-fitted and stylish blouse that complements the saree’s color and design. Experiment with different necklines and sleeve patterns to create a modern or traditional look, depending on your taste.
  6. Accessories: Accessorizing your saree appropriately can elevate your overall look. Add statement earrings, a delicate necklace, or a chic clutch to enhance your outfit. Pay attention to your footwear as well; heels or wedges usually work best with sarees.
  7. Hairstyle and Makeup: Your hairstyle and makeup should complement the saree and the occasion. Choose a hairstyle that keeps your hair neat and enhances your facial features. A classic updo or loose curls can work well. For makeup, go for a look that highlights your best features while maintaining a polished and elegant appearance.
  8. Comfort: Remember that you will be wearing the saree for an extended period, so ensure it fits well and is comfortable to carry.

 

Saree colors to choose for a farewell party

The best colors to wear for a farewell party depend on your personal style, the dress code (if any), the formality of the event, and the overall theme (if there is one). However, there are some classic and universally flattering colors that work well for farewell parties. Here are some suggestions:

  • Classic Black: Black is a timeless color that exudes sophistication and elegance. It’s a safe and stylish choice for almost any farewell party, regardless of the event’s formality.
  • Elegant Navy Blue: Navy blue is a rich and refined color that can add a touch of formality without being as stark as black. It suits a variety of skin tones and is suitable for both daytime and evening events.
  • Chic Neutrals: Neutral colors like beige, taupe, and cream can create a polished and classy look. They also provide an excellent canvas to accessorize with colorful or metallic accents.
  • Burgundy or Deep Red: Deep, rich reds like burgundy or maroon can make a bold statement while maintaining an air of sophistication. These colors are especially suitable for evening or formal farewell parties.
  • Emerald Green: Green, particularly emerald green, is a luxurious and eye-catching color that works well for farewell parties, especially during the warmer months.
  • Royal or Cobalt Blue: Royal blue or cobalt blue can add vibrancy and energy to your look. These shades work well for both formal and semi-formal farewell parties.
  • Regal Purple: Purple is a regal and elegant color that can make you stand out in a crowd. It’s a great choice for evening or more upscale farewell events.
  • Soft Pastels: If the farewell party has a more casual or daytime vibe, consider soft pastel colors like blush pink, baby blue, or mint green. These hues are light, refreshing, and create a gentle, feminine look.

Remember that the best color for you ultimately depends on your individual preferences, skin tone, and personal style. The key is to feel comfortable, confident, and stylish in whatever color you choose to wear. If you’re unsure about the dress code or the event’s theme, don’t hesitate to ask the host or organizer for guidance.

Draping the saree for farewell party

Draping a saree for a party requires attention to detail and a stylish presentation. The way you drape the saree can significantly impact your overall look. Here’s a step-by-step guide to draping a saree for a party:

  1. Preparation: Start by wearing a well-fitted blouse and a matching petticoat that complements the saree color. Make sure the petticoat is tied securely at your waist.
  2. Tuck in the Saree: Begin by tucking the plain end of the saree (non-pallu end) into the petticoat at your right hip. Make sure the bottom border is at the floor level for the desired length.
  3. Make Pleats: Hold the remaining fabric and start making pleats (approximately 5-7 pleats) about 5-6 inches wide, ensuring they are even and neat. Once you’ve made the pleats, tuck them into the petticoat, slightly to the left of the navel. The pleats should face left.
  4. Drape the Pallu: Take the loose end of the saree (pallu) and bring it around your back over the left shoulder, letting it fall gracefully behind you. Adjust the length of the pallu as per your preference; it can be long and flowing or shorter and pleated.
  5. Secure the Pallu: You can pin the pallu to your blouse on the left shoulder to keep it in place. Alternatively, you can use a decorative brooch or saree pin to add a touch of elegance.
  6. Arrange the Pallu: Arrange the pallu to fall beautifully over your left arm, or you can let it fall freely over your shoulder and arm.
  7. Adjust the Pleats: Ensure that the pleats are arranged neatly and spread evenly across the front. Adjust their width and make sure they are straight and not too loose or too tight.
  8. Final Touches: Check the saree draping from all angles and make any necessary adjustments to ensure it looks elegant and flawless. Don’t forget to arrange the saree at the front to create a smooth and graceful appearance.

Remember, practice makes perfect. If you are trying a new draping style or have a designer or heavy saree, consider practicing a few times before the actual event. Saree draping can be an art, and the more you practice, the more comfortable you’ll become with different styles and techniques.
